- Summary
- "Biochemistry and Physiology of Anaerobic Bacteria will be of general interest to microbiologists, especially to investigators concerned with microbial physiology, energy generation in microorganisms, and metabolic potentials in environmental and industrial settings. The book should be of special interest to those who study anaerobes from a purely academic viewpoint as well as to investigators who are interested in metal-containing enzymes and proteins."--BOOK JACKET.
